Seongsan Ilchulbong, also known as Sunrise Peak, is a stunning volcanic crater. It’s renowned for its breathtaking sunrise views and unique geological features. You can hike up the well-maintained trail to the summit, where you’ll be rewarded with panoramic views of the surrounding landscape and ocean. On clear days, you might also catch a traditional haenyeo (female diver) performance, showcasing the island’s rich maritime heritage. It’s a perfect destination for both outdoor enthusiasts and those interested in local culture.
Jeju Dongmun Market is a popular traditional market where locals gather to shop for fresh produce, seafood, and everyday groceries. It’s a great place to experience Jeju’s local food culture and find traditional snacks, herbs, and local ingredients. The market also offers a variety of souvenirs and Jeju-themed products at affordable prices, making it a favorite spot for both residents and tourists.
Jeju Olle Maeil Market is another vibrant traditional market, where locals go to buy fresh produce, seafood, and daily essentials. It’s well-known for its friendly atmosphere and local delicacies, including Jeju black pork, fresh fruits, and handmade snacks. Visitors can also find unique Jeju souvenirs at reasonable prices, making it a great spot to shop for gifts.
